package/libite: add dependency on MMU, requires fork()
Unfortunately, parts of the library is not very no-MMU friendly atm.
The below check fails due to runbg.c requiring fork().
$ ./utils/test-pkg -c libite.config -p libite
bootlin-armv5-uclibc [1/6]: OK
bootlin-armv7-glibc [2/6]: OK
bootlin-armv7m-uclibc [3/6]: FAILED
bootlin-x86-64-musl [4/6]: OK
br-arm-full-static [5/6]: OK
arm-aarch64 [6/6]: OK
The dependency was introduced in libite v2.6.0, so this patch should
be backported to v2025.02.x.
